Sports and Tourist Center "Vlasina", Vlasotince, Serbia

Concept 
For an architecture got its real meaning it must come from the depths of the environment and the people who built it. Accordingly, we sought to develop the most popular part of the city a new dimension, contour and value for which future generations will become a current favorite place to stay for love, recreation and sport.
The identity of the spirit of place (genius loci), a way of being and feeling like the world to ourselves and to others, it should be nurtured and encouraged, but without selfishness and intolerance. By creating a specific area, we returned to architecture and human realities of life events and needs. Existing architecture of nature, and nature is the simplest form of architecture, it becomes real and believable. Its autonomy, with the contribution of human labor and ideas that shape the landscape and transform the transition from sphere to sphere of abstract architecture of life.
Simple architectural units were brought to the complex spatial relationships with their position, rhythm, pitch, sequence, line shifts and components and details. Different altitudes has been running the impression of space, power running.
Each level of the field can be symbolically correspond to the age of its customers - the lowest level might be best suited for the youngest, middle level and the highest level of teenagers older population. However, the goal was not to make a children's playground, we do not want. We want the whole complex, the whole city is one big playground. We do not want any big or small, or adults - people want humans and a sense of disciplined freedom among them, because the experience of space is not the privilege of gifted individuals rather than biological function.
